Marek,

the Promise RAID set assembly still has name issues, which lead to creating
names of devices wrongly. I'm working on this now...

Please send me your metadata so that I can test your case:

# dmraid -rD
# tar jxcvf pdc-Marek_Olszewski.tar.bz2 *.dat *.offset

I need the *.tar.bz2 file.
